Phūṭkāra is a word in the Sanskrit language where it represents a Noun. This page shows the declension shemes of the possible gender(s) including the grammatical case and number. Note that Sanskrit has eight cases, three numbers and three different genders. The Sanskrit noun Phūṭkāra is found in masculine and neuter form. These declensions are also used for the adjectives.

Masculine declension scheme:
This is the Masculine declension of the word Phūṭkāra following the rules for -a.
| single | dual | plural | |
|---|---|---|---|
| nominative. | phūṭkāraḥ | phūṭkārau | phūṭkārāḥ |
| accusative. | phūṭkāram | phūṭkārau | phūṭkārān |
| instrumental. | phūṭkāreṇa | phūṭkārābhyām | phūṭkāraiḥ |
| dative. | phūṭkārāya | phūṭkārābhyām | phūṭkārebhyaḥ |
| ablative. | phūṭkārāt | phūṭkārābhyām | phūṭkārebhyaḥ |
| genitive. | phūṭkārasya | phūṭkārayoḥ | phūṭkārāṇām |
| locative. | phūṭkāre | phūṭkārayoḥ | phūṭkāreṣu |
| vocative. | phūṭkāra | phūṭkārau | phūṭkārāḥ |
| Compound: | phūṭkāra- | ||
| Adverb: | -phūṭkāram | -phūṭkārāt | ||
Neuter declension scheme:
This is the Neuter declension of the word Phūṭkāra following the rules for -a.
| single | dual | plural | |
|---|---|---|---|
| nominative. | phūṭkāram | phūṭkāre | phūṭkārāṇi |
| accusative. | phūṭkāram | phūṭkāre | phūṭkārāṇi |
| instrumental. | phūṭkāreṇa | phūṭkārābhyām | phūṭkāraiḥ |
| dative. | phūṭkārāya | phūṭkārābhyām | phūṭkārebhyaḥ |
| ablative. | phūṭkārāt | phūṭkārābhyām | phūṭkārebhyaḥ |
| genitive. | phūṭkārasya | phūṭkārayoḥ | phūṭkārāṇām |
| locative. | phūṭkāre | phūṭkārayoḥ | phūṭkāreṣu |
| vocative. | phūṭkāra | phūṭkāre | phūṭkārāṇi |
| Compound: | phūṭkāra- | ||
| Adverb: | -phūṭkāram | -phūṭkārāt | ||
